What are the requirements for updating the photograph in the DPI during renewal?

The requirements for updating the photograph in the DPI during renewal include presenting the expired DPI, completing the corresponding form, and paying the fee established by the National Registry of Persons (RENAP). Additionally, the standard renewal process must be followed.

How has legislation been enacted in Costa Rica to address the challenge of lost or stolen identification documents?

Legislation in Costa Rica addresses the challenge of loss or theft of identification documents by implementing procedures for the replacement of ID cards. Affected citizens must follow a legal process that includes the corresponding complaint and the presentation of the required documents, guaranteeing a legal framework for the safe and efficient replacement of lost or stolen documents.
